Market Summary

The automotive coupling market is a critical segment within the broader automotive and transportation industry, focusing on components that connect various parts of a vehicle's drivetrain and transmission systems. These couplings play an indispensable role in ensuring efficient power transmission, enhancing vehicle performance, and improving overall driving dynamics. The market is characterized by continuous innovation, driven by the escalating demand for advanced automotive technologies and the global shift toward electric and hybrid vehicles. Key industry participants are consistently engaged in research and development activities to introduce products that offer superior durability, reduced maintenance, and compatibility with next-generation vehicle architectures. Geographically, the market demonstrates a widespread presence, with significant activities observed across developed and emerging economies, each contributing to the growth trajectory through localized demand patterns and manufacturing capabilities. The competitive landscape is marked by the presence of established multinational corporations and specialized manufacturers, all vying for market share through strategic initiatives such as mergers, acquisitions, and collaborations.

Type Insights

Automotive couplings are categorized into several types based on their design, functionality, and application within vehicle systems. Rigid couplings represent a fundamental type, characterized by their simple construction and ability to maintain a fixed connection between two shafts, making them suitable for applications where alignment is precise and misalignment is negligible. Flexible couplings, on the other hand, are designed to accommodate various forms of misalignment, including angular, parallel, and axial, thereby protecting connected equipment from vibrations and shocks; common variants include jaw couplings, gear couplings, and elastomeric couplings. Hydraulic couplings utilize fluid dynamics to transmit power, offering smooth engagement and torque conversion, which is particularly beneficial in applications requiring controlled acceleration and deceleration. Additionally, magnetic couplings are emerging as an innovative solution, especially in electric vehicles, where they provide contactless torque transmission, reducing wear and maintenance requirements. Each coupling type offers distinct advantages and is selected based on specific vehicle requirements, operational conditions, and performance criteria, reflecting the diverse needs of modern automotive engineering.

Application Insights

Automotive couplings find applications across a wide spectrum of vehicle systems, each demanding unique performance characteristics and reliability standards. In internal combustion engine vehicles, couplings are extensively used in the drivetrain and transmission systems to facilitate smooth power transfer from the engine to the wheels, enhancing driving comfort and efficiency. They are also critical in steering mechanisms, where they contribute to precise control and responsiveness. The advent of electric vehicles has expanded the application scope, with couplings being integral to electric drivetrains, battery cooling systems, and auxiliary power units, where they must handle high torques and operate efficiently under varying load conditions. Commercial vehicles, including trucks and buses, utilize heavy-duty couplings designed to withstand rigorous operational demands and extended service intervals. Additionally, couplings are employed in all-wheel and four-wheel drive systems, enabling seamless torque distribution between axles for improved traction and stability. The diversification of applications underscores the versatility of automotive couplings and their indispensable role in advancing vehicle technology and performance.

FAQs

What is an automotive coupling? An automotive coupling is a mechanical device used to connect two shafts together at their ends for the purpose of transmitting power. It allows for the transfer of torque and rotation between components, while accommodating misalignment and reducing shock loads in vehicle drivetrains and other systems.

What are the different types of automotive couplings? The primary types include rigid couplings, which provide a solid connection; flexible couplings, designed to handle misalignment and vibrations; hydraulic couplings, using fluid for power transmission; and magnetic couplings, offering contactless torque transfer, especially useful in electric vehicles.

How do automotive couplings improve vehicle performance? Automotive couplings enhance vehicle performance by ensuring efficient power transmission, reducing energy losses, minimizing vibrations and noise, and improving the overall reliability and longevity of drivetrain components. They contribute to smoother operation and better fuel efficiency.

What are the key materials used in manufacturing automotive couplings? Common materials include high-strength steel, aluminum alloys, and advanced composites. These materials are chosen for their durability, lightweight properties, and resistance to wear and corrosion, which are essential for meeting automotive performance and safety standards.

How is the automotive coupling market evolving with electric vehicles? The market is adapting by developing specialized couplings for electric vehicles that can handle high torque levels, provide efficient power transmission in electric drivetrains, and contribute to noise reduction. Innovations include the use of magnetic and smart couplings integrated with vehicle control systems.

What factors should be considered when selecting an automotive coupling? Key factors include the type of application, torque requirements, operational speed, misalignment tolerance, environmental conditions, and compatibility with other vehicle systems. Additionally, factors like cost, maintenance needs, and regulatory compliance play a crucial role in the selection process.
